Reading shells is originally from the African religion of Ifa of the Yoruba People. From Ifa comes other religions such as Santeria, Vodun, Candomble, etc. In Ifa it is called "opele" and this is a form of divination done by the "babalawo" or Ifa priest. He/she will toss these shells and they will form 8 symbols in one toss. These symbols are read to interpret issues in the querent's life.
